Problem

Modern applications require databases that can handle both transactional and analytical workloads efficiently, but traditional databases often struggle to scale and maintain strong ACID compliance while delivering real-time analytics. This leads to complex architectures with separate systems for OLTP and OLAP, increasing development overhead and data latency. Sharding further complicates matters, limiting JOIN operations and hindering application agility.

Solution

Regatta is a distributed SQL database designed for high-performance transactional, analytical, and agentic AI workloads, providing strong ACID compliance at any scale. Its OLxP architecture allows applications to perform both OLTP and OLAP operations without compromising performance or consistency, eliminating the need for separate systems and ETL processes. Regatta offers total elasticity, enabling non-disruptive modifications and simplifying complex data environments. As a drop-in replacement for Postgres, Regatta reduces code complexity and accelerates deployment times, allowing developers to focus on building features rather than managing database infrastructure.
